In our modern world, exposure to various chemicals is a reality, and understanding our body's interaction with them is crucial for maintaining health. Among the most common environmental exposures are to pesticides, particularly pyrethroids, which are widely used in homes, gardens, and agriculture. A critical tool for assessing this exposure is the measurement of 3-phenoxybenzoic acid (3-PBA) in urine, a primary metabolite of many pyrethroid insecticides.

Pyrethroids are a class of synthetic insecticides that act by disrupting the nervous systems of insects. They are found in numerous household products, from bug sprays to pet flea treatments. Due to their broad use, many people are exposed to pyrethroids regularly. When this exposure occurs, the body metabolizes these chemicals, and 3-PBA is excreted in the urine. The amount of 3-PBA detected in a urine sample provides a direct indication of recent pyrethroid exposure. High levels of urinary 3-phenoxybenzoic acid can suggest significant exposure, often linked to frequent use of pyrethroid-containing products.

The presence of 3-PBA in urine is a significant finding in public health research. Studies have shown that a substantial portion of the population has detectable levels of 3-PBA, indicating widespread exposure to pyrethroids. This exposure has been investigated for its potential association with various health issues, including neurological and developmental problems, particularly in vulnerable groups like children and the elderly. Understanding what influences these levels—such as household insecticide use frequency—is vital for informing preventive measures.
